== Transport: Returned Demo Units ==

This page covers the standard flow for demo units returned from Merrix Instruments field events. The shift lead stages returns in cage D, each unit in its original foam case with the return slip taped to the lid. Batteries must be at storage charge before boxing. Collections run Tuesdays via Copperline Haulage; mixed loads are not permitted. The shift lead verifies the driver's run number, then gives the courier the release phrase written below.

handover note for yagef-bagep: the drudor pelius courier leaves the kasdor zorvan norir ledger at gate 8016 under passcode 755406

### 2.8.1 — Key rotation heads-up

Quick one for the new folks: we rotated the signing key after the Meridelle calendar sync conflict fix shipped twice under the old key (long story, double-booked events, angry dashboards). Old key is now revoked, so re-pull before your next deploy or signing will fail. The new deploy key is below.

rollout seal: bky4_x7Gc

### Assigning Drivers with the RouteMuse Heuristic

When a new delivery lands, RouteMuse scores every available driver on proximity, current load, and recent idle time, then picks the top match. Don't overthink it — the scoring weights live in config, not code. To poke at the `/assign/preview` endpoint from your local setup, call it with the bearer token below.

login token, bagug-kafop: eyJhbGciOiJIUzI1NiIsInR5cCI6IkpXVCJ9.eyJzdWIiOiIcMLov2In0.Z5RLDIfp

Welcome aboard! A quick note on the Squallbird crash-report pipeline before you dig in. Crashes from the Murretto mobile app land in an ingest queue, get symbolicated, then flow into the triage dashboard. Most days it runs itself. Your main job is keeping the symbol store fresh after each release — stale symbols mean garbage stack traces. The symbol store's admin vault seals itself weekly as a precaution. When you need to re-upload symbols, unseal it with the passphrase below.

vault phrase of tajeg-tageg = pelix-druix-holius-briael-zorwyn-frawyn-fraox-norok-drueth-aldiel